One of the easy and tastiest sweet dish is khowa and coconut barfi. This is a very simple, easy and tasty dish. So let's start preparing this yummy sweet dish.
Serves
-
4
Cooking
time
-
10
min
Preperation
time
-
10
min

Ingredients
- Coconut ( grated ) - 1 cup
- Khowa - 1 cup
- Milk - 1 cup
- Milk powder - 1tbsp
- Sugar -1 cup
- Cardomon - 1/4 tsp
- Ghee - 4 to 5 tbsp

Procedure:
- In a pan add ghee, then add coconut and fry it in low flame for 2 min.
- In another pan add khowa and 1 cup of sugar.
- Stir it well then add the fried coconut. Add milk and stir well in low flame.
- Then add cardomon powder and 1 tbsp of milk powder and mix it well.
- Now, take a plate add 2 tbsp of ghee to it spread through the plate.
- Now take the mixture and spread neatly through out the plate.
- Now you can make small round balls or you can cut the mixture that is one the plate using a knife and cut them to equal squares.
- Khowa coconut berfi is ready to eat.
